University of Oregon is a wonderful decision for students pursuing a degree in accounting. UO is a fairly large public university located in the midsize city of Eugene. A Best Colleges rank of #195 out of 2,217 schools nationwide means UO is a great university overall.

There were about 134 accounting students who graduated with this degree at UO in the most recent data year. Degree recipients from the accounting major at University of Oregon get $6,365 above the standard college grad with the same degree when they enter the workforce.

It is hard to beat Portland State University if you wish to pursue a degree in accounting. Portland State University is a fairly large public university located in the city of Portland. A Best Colleges rank of #462 out of 2,217 schools nationwide means Portland State University is a great university overall.

There were approximately 234 accounting students who graduated with this degree at Portland State University in the most recent year we have data available. After graduation, accounting degree recipients usually make about $48,011 in their early careers.

Portland Community College is one of the finest schools in the United States for getting a degree in accounting. Portland Community College is a fairly large public college located in the city of Portland. A Best Colleges rank of #300 out of 2,217 schools nationwide means Portland Community College is a great college overall.

There were about 181 accounting students who graduated with this degree at Portland Community College in the most recent data year. Graduates who receive their degree from the accounting program make an average of $37,686 in the first couple years of their career.

Oregon State University is a good option for students pursuing a degree in accounting. Oregon State is a fairly large public university located in the city of Corvallis. A Best Colleges rank of #210 out of 2,217 schools nationwide means Oregon State is a great university overall.

There were about 70 accounting students who graduated with this degree at Oregon State in the most recent data year. Students who graduate with their degree from the accounting program report average early career wages of $48,601.
